I'm new to OpenFOAM and I'm running my first simulation (not tutorial).
So in the controlDict file I've specified a startTime = 0, endTime = 0.5, and deltaT = 0.005. The solver starts up and runs a few time steps and stops. What would be causing this to happen? > Courant Number mean: 117.402 max: 1838.74
This Co number is way too large. You have to reduce your time step.
